Chicken Kabob Marinade

1/2 c. olive oil
1/4 c. red wine vinegar
1/2 tsp. sea salt
1 tsp. minced garlic
1/2 tsp. black pepper
1/2 tsp. dried basil
1/2 tsp. dried oregano
1/2 tsp. thyme
3-4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ut up

Mix marinade ingredients in 1-2 freezer bags (depends on the size of your family). Cut up chicken and place in/divide between bags. Seal bags & mix chicken with marinade. Freeze bag(s).

To Serve: Thaw bag overnight in fridge. Place chicken on grill skewers and grill over low-med heat until chicken is done. Serve with grilled veggies & rice.
